Bournemouth Beach is truly a hidden gem on the southern coast of England. Located just 2 hours by train from London, it's a perfect getaway from the city's hustle and bustle. 🚉To reach this splendid seaside destination, you can take a direct train from London Waterloo to Bournemouth. The journey treats you to picturesque landscapes that immediately put you in a vacation mood.
Once you arrive, 🍽️the options to tantalize your taste buds are endless. If you're looking for authentic seafood cuisine, "The Crab Shed" restaurant is an excellent choice. Dishes featuring locally caught fresh seafood are a sensory delight. For a more casual experience, try "Harry Ramsden's" for a classic British fish and chips with a panoramic beach view.
When it comes to accommodation, Bournemouth offers a wide range of options. If you're seeking a luxurious stay, "The Green House" 🏩hotel is an elegant eco-friendly choice, located just steps away from the beach. For a more budget-friendly option, coastal guesthouses provide cozy comfort and quick access to the sand and sea.
The beach itself takes center stage. With miles of golden sands and azure waters, it's the perfect spot for sunbathing, leisurely strolls along the shoreline, or even engaging in water activities like surfing and paddleboarding. Beachfront facilities allow you to rent equipment and find shelter in the shade when desired.
In summary, Bournemouth Beach is a destination that offers a perfect blend of relaxation, delightful food, and spectacular scenery. Visiting Bournemouth in winter
Took a 2.5 hrs train trip from London to Bournemouth. It was cold at the beachside, but luckily it was sunny. Enjoying the ceaseless yet soothing sound of the sea waves, it was nice observing people walking their dogs and taking a stroll near the sea. The pier was located at the center, but unfortunately the symbolic huge observation wheel was not open, leaving the structure standing there. It’s quite a different vibe visiting seaside in winter.
